Three desperate children from Karlsdorf near Seeboden (Carinthia) can laugh again. The Spittal/Drau fire brigade rescued their beloved cat from a tree on Saturday morning.
Only the cat itself knows why cat “Nikita” went to such dizzying heights, but she could neither move forward nor backward in a tree more than 20 meters high and was stuck. The concerned owners could only ask the fire brigade for help. The three children in particular were in despair.
Scared and soaked
But Carinthia’s fire brigades have a big heart for animals. Therefore, the volunteer fire brigade from Spittal an der Drau arrived with the turntable ladder and group commander Lucas Weger was able to rescue the scared and soaked cat “Nikita” unharmed from the tree and hand it over to the happy children Mailin, Nike and Raphael. A happy ending in all situations and a big thank you to the fire brigade.
